Abstract
Ascaris lumbricoides is the most common roundworm in warm and temperat e areas. Although radiological features of Ascaris lumbricoides are we ll defined, there are only a few reports on the ultrasonographic findi ngs of intestinal ascariasis. In our two patients with no acute abdomi nal symptoms, intestinal ascariasis was initially diagnosed by abdomin al ultrasonography. In both patients, tubular structures in the segmen ts of the small intestine were demonstrated by ultrasonography.
